Indicator name* Subcategory I Subcategory II Subcategory III Technical name* Scale* Short description Data origin*
Access to social assistance for permanent migrant workers isr_permmig_socass_access_s Metric It is measured if in the years of data collection, migrant workers who held a permanent residence permit did have a legal claim to tax-funded social assistance Original CRC Data
Access to social assistance for temporary migrant workers isr_tempmig_socass_access_s Metric It is measured if in the years of data collection, migrant workers who held a temporary residence permit did have a legal claim to tax-funded social assistance Original CRC Data
Conditions of Sponsorship (Third-Country Nationals, TCNs) isr_famitcn_socben_conseq_s Metric It is measured if sponsors who were Third Country Nationals (TCNs) were required not to rely on social welfare Original CRC Data
